5 Ways to Respond to People Who Violate Your Boundaries

WebA person with healthy boundaries learns to say "yes" without resentment and "no" without guilt. However, boundaries may cause problems with some people in your life even when you are good at setting and protecting them. A lack of boundaries at work can invite toxic situations, overwhelm, disrespect, and increased … WebBoundaries mark the emotional and physical lines by which a relationship is governed. Healthy boundaries allow for genuine care and love to thrive and for two people to live as both individuals and a harmonious unit. They allow genuine and godly love to thrive. But if abuse is present, boundaries are often absent, unclear or disrespected.
